III. The Clockmakers
To understand the weight of this “1 second", we must strip the second of its mystique. It is not a
cosmic unit. It is a human invention, born from the dusty mathematics of ancient civilizations.
The Egyptians gave us the 24-hour day—not from astronomical precision, but from a habit of
counting with knuckles and dividing the night into 12 parts based on the rising of stars. The
Sumerians gave us base-60—not because it was sacred, but because 60 is divisible by 1, 2, 3, 4,
5, and 6, making trade and fractions a breeze.
